9, Hadleigh Court High Road, Broxbourne, EN10 6PS is a leasehold flat built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 646 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£266,576 , which equates to approximately £413 per square foot. It was last sold on 7 Aug 2019 for £249,000. Since then, the value has increased by £17,576, representing a 7.1% increase, or approximately 1.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£266,576 is:

  • 33.5% lower than the average property price on High Road
  • 9.7% higher than the average in the EN10 6PS postcode area
  • and 54.2% lower than the average price for Broxbourne as a whole

9, Hadleigh Court High Road, Broxbourne, Hertfordshire, EN10 6PS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 22 Jun 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 17 Jul 2012, when the property was rated B. The current rating of D re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 17.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ance 0.15 w/m?k to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ance 0.19 w/m?k to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from very good to poor.
  • The windows were upgraded from high performance gl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 75%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from very good to very poor.
